*{box-sizing:border-box}html,body,#root{min-height:100%;margin:0}body{background:#f4f6f8}.admin-shell{min-height:100vh}.admin-sider{background:#fff;border-right:1px solid #e8edf2}.brand{height:72px;display:flex;align-items:center;gap:12px;padding:16px;border-bottom:1px solid #edf0f3}.brand-mark{display:flex;align-items:center;justify-content:center;color:#fff;font-weight:700;background:#07c160}.brand-mark{width:38px;height:38px;border-radius:8px;font-size:18px}.brand-title{font-size:16px;font-weight:700;color:#172033}.brand-subtitle{margin-top:3px;font-size:12px;color:#7b8494}.admin-content{min-height:100vh;padding:24px;background:#f4f6f8}.page{width:100%;max-width:none}.full-width{width:100%}.metric-grid,.settings-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:12px}.settings-wide-card{grid-column:span 2}.settings-save-button{margin-top:16px}.metric-card{border-radius:8px}.table-section{margin-top:18px}.admin-agent-table .ant-table-cell{white-space:nowrap}.table-toolbar{display:flex;flex-direction:column;align-items:stretch;gap:12px}.table-toolbar-main{display:flex;align-items:center;justify-content:space-between;gap:12px}.agent-filter-bar{display:flex;align-items:center;flex-wrap:wrap;gap:10px}.agent-filter-control{min-width:160px}.agent-name-search{width:280px;max-width:100%}.record-message{margin-bottom:0!important;max-width:360px}.create-mode-panel{border-radius:8px}.create-mode-header{display:flex;align-items:center;justify-content:space-between;gap:16px}.upload-hint{margin-top:8px;color:#7b8494;font-size:12px}.ops-form{padding:18px;background:#fff;border:1px solid #e6ebf0;border-radius:8px}.form-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:12px}.edit-form-grid{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:12px}.agent-edit-form{padding-top:8px}.avatar-ai-field{display:flex;flex-wrap:wrap;align-items:center;gap:10px}.admin-dimensions{display:flex;flex-direction:column;gap:12px}.admin-dimension-header{display:flex;align-items:center;justify-content:space-between;gap:12px}.admin-dimension-card{border-radius:8px}.page-alert{margin-bottom:16px}.loading-panel{width:100%;padding:24px;background:#fff;border:1px solid #e6ebf0;border-radius:8px}.loading-panel{display:flex;align-items:center;gap:12px}@media(max-width:720px){.admin-sider{display:none}.admin-content{padding:16px}.metric-grid,.settings-grid,.form-grid,.edit-form-grid{grid-template-columns:1fr}.table-toolbar{align-items:flex-start}.table-toolbar-main{align-items:flex-start;flex-direction:column}.agent-filter-control,.agent-name-search{width:100%}}
